A single point from 21 races in 2019 heralded the worst campaign in Williams’ history, despite the addition of former Grand Prix winner Robert Kubica.
On the flip side, rookie George Russell marked himself out as a star of the future, and this year leads the charge alongside new rookie team mate Nicholas Latifi.
Claire Williams insists 2020 marks a ‘fresh start’ for the famous squad, and with the first pre-season test a major improvement on last year’s, things seem to be looking up.
